The Big East will not split. The new TV contract with ESPN is quite lucrative and part of the deal is the basketball schools. The basketball schools don't get the BCS money so there's no motivation for the F-Ball schools to break appart from them.

The next conference shake-up will occur when CUSA finally splits into 2 new conferences, one east, one west. Travel costs for Olympic sports will not be sustainable on non-BCS budgets.

As for the CAA, 14 schools is cumbersome but there seems to be no motivation for a split when one of the new conferences formed from it will have to wait several years before qualifing for an automatic playoff spot.

I don't know about NCAA rules on the matter. However, I do know that the BE does not require member schools to play each other in non-revenue individual, sports during the regular season. If the BE sponsors the sport, member schools are only required to play in the conf tourny. I think BE schools playing Lax were allowed to opt out, because their programs were established prior tot the BE sponsoring Lax. If I remember it correctly, the BE voted to sponsor Lax only if it could get enough members to play under the BE banner. Also I remember that daU was not forced to join the BE in all sports, when it came it. It kept its baseball program as an independent.
